
No proof Cinnamon Rolls
Ingredients
For dough:
-
250 g flour
-
1 tbsp sugar
-
1 tsp baking powder
-
120 ml milk
-
40 g butter (melted)
For filling:
-
30 g butter (softened)
-
3 tbsp of brown sugar
-
1 tsp cinnamon
Instructions
1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(180°C)
2. In a large bowl, use a whisk, spoon, or electric mixer to gently combine the flour, sugar, baking powder, milk, and melted butter until you have a smooth, soft dough.
3. On a lightly floured surface, roll the dough out into a rectangle. Spread a thin layer of butter over the top, then generously sprinkle with sugar and cinnamon, making sure to cover the surface evenly.
4. Starting from the long side, roll the dough tightly into a log. Using a sharp knife, slice it into 6–8 even rolls.
5. Arrange the rolls on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per and bake for 20–25 minutes, or until they turn a beautiful golden color and your kitchen smells amazing.
6. If you’d like, drizzle the warm rolls with a simple icing made from powdered sugar and a splash of milk for an extra touch of sweetness (just mix it in a small bowl).
